The Basics Of Two Line Phones

Two line phones are a versatile communication tool that allows users to manage two separate phone lines from a single device. These phones are equipped with two distinct phone numbers, enabling users to make and receive calls on each line independently. This feature is particularly useful for individuals who need to segregate personal and business calls, or for households where multiple individuals may need access to separate phone lines.

Two line phones typically come with a variety of features such as call waiting, caller ID, and conference calling capabilities. Users can easily switch between the two lines, putting one call on hold while taking a call on the other line. Some models also offer the ability to conference multiple parties into a single call, enhancing communication efficiency for users.

In addition to their functionality, two line phones are often designed with user-friendly interfaces and display screens that make it easy to navigate between the two lines and access different features. These phones can be a valuable asset for businesses that require multiple phone lines, as well as for individuals who seek convenient communication solutions in their daily lives.

Setting Up A Two Line Phone System

When setting up a two line phone system, the first step is to ensure that you have all the necessary equipment. This includes having a two line phone with the capability to handle two separate phone numbers, as well as a compatible two line phone jack or splitter to connect to your existing phone line. It is important to carefully read the instruction manual that comes with your two line phone to properly set it up according to the manufacturer’s guidelines.

Next, you will need to determine how you want to allocate the two phone lines. You can designate one line for personal calls and the other for business calls, or customize the setup based on your specific needs. Make sure to configure the phone system settings accordingly to differentiate between the two lines and manage incoming calls effectively.

After physically connecting the two line phone and configuring the settings, test the system to ensure both phone lines are functioning correctly. Make test calls from each line to verify call quality and proper call routing. Adjust any settings as needed to optimize the performance of your two line phone system for seamless communication.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

When it comes to troubleshooting common issues with a two-line phone, there are a few key areas to focus on. First, check the physical connections and cords to ensure everything is plugged in securely. Sometimes, a loose connection can result in one of the lines not working properly. Additionally, inspect the phone lines themselves to see if there are any visible damages or cuts that may be causing issues.

If the physical connections seem fine, the next step is to check the settings on the phone. Make sure the lines are properly assigned and that there are no programming errors that could be affecting the functionality of the device. It’s also a good idea to power cycle the phone by unplugging it, waiting a few seconds, and then plugging it back in to see if that resolves the problem.

If you are still experiencing issues after checking the physical connections and settings, it may be helpful to consult the user manual for troubleshooting tips specific to your two-line phone model. In some cases, contacting customer support for further assistance may be necessary to pinpoint and resolve any persistent issues.

Comparing Analog Vs Digital Two Line Phones

Analog and digital two-line phones are two distinct technologies that cater to the needs of various users. Analog two-line phones operate based on traditional electrical signals transmitted through copper wires, offering reliable and straightforward communication. On the other hand, digital two-line phones convert sound into binary data for transmission over digital networks, providing enhanced clarity and additional features.

When comparing analog and digital two-line phones, several factors come into play. Analog phones are generally more cost-effective and easier to set up, making them suitable for basic communication needs. In contrast, digital phones offer advanced functionalities such as voicemail, caller ID, and conferencing capabilities, making them ideal for professional settings requiring efficient communication solutions.

Ultimately, the choice between analog and digital two-line phones depends on individual preferences and specific requirements. While analog phones offer simplicity and affordability, digital phones provide a broader range of features and superior sound quality. Understanding the differences between these technologies is essential for selecting the most suitable option based on your communication needs and budget constraints.

Can You Use A Two Line Phone With Just One Phone Line?

Yes, you can use a two-line phone with just one phone line. In this case, you would only be able to make and receive calls on one line while the other line remains inactive. The extra line on the phone can be helpful if you plan to expand and add a second phone line in the future.
